Antena 3 is moving ahead with plans for its eleventh edition of a beloved talent show. The premise stays the same: a familiar celebrity performs as a different singer each week, while a panel of judges evaluates impersonations, vocal range, and stage presence. The production, in collaboration with a major network group, has quietly been collecting profiles for months to assemble a fresh cast that could feature actors, hosts, musicians, comedians, and other notable talents.

Information gathered indicates that casting is still underway, but several profiles have already been finalized. The show will once again feature Manel Fuentes guiding the introductions, with a judging panel that includes Chenoa, Carlos Latre, Lolita, and Àngel Llácer returning to their familiar roles.

  • Valeria Ros From Zapeando to the talent show

Valeria Ros, a long-time television presence known for acting and comedy, makes a bold leap onto the show. She must demonstrate vocal prowess and impersonation skill while embodying the styles of celebrated artists. Her journey on stage will be watched closely by viewers who know her for a mix of humor and charm.

In addition to competing, Ros has another major project on the horizon. She is set to host a new program on Atresplayer, a format described as bold and innovative, produced by a prominent production company within the group. The project is anticipated to debut soon and will add another layer to her evolving television career.

  • David Bustamante Competing in the talent show again after previous appearances

David Bustamante enters the eleventh edition as one of the country’s notable vocal talents. Known for his enduring music career that rose to fame in the early 2000s, he faces the aim of recreating past performances within the show’s distinctive framework. The question remains whether his recent stage work will translate into the high-energy impressions demanded by the competition.

Bustamante’s journey recalls earlier television triumphs, including a celebrated dance-focused season on another program where he claimed top honors. His experience in front of diverse audiences adds depth to the competition, and fans will be eager to see how his artistry translates to the impersonation format and the playful rivalries that unfold on screen.
